Frequently asked questions
Tera FM is an audio news radio that summarizes online stories into short, listenable updates and organizes them into curated stations. Think of it as internet radio for news — AI-summarized stories from sources like Hacker News, BBC, Bloomberg, and TechCrunch.
Yes! During our launch period, all 44+ channels are completely free — no login required. Just press play and start listening.
Channel content is refreshed every 4 hours with the latest stories. Curated stations (like Morning Focus and ADHD FM) are updated daily with fresh selections.
Podcasts are long-form (20-60 minutes). Tera FM is radio-style: 5-10 minute briefings, AI-summarized stories, and stations you can jump between. Perfect for quick catch-ups.
Choose from 44+ channels including Hacker News, BBC News, TechCrunch, Bloomberg, NPR, The Verge, and curated stations like Morning Focus, Founder FM, and ADHD FM.
Yes! Tera FM supports multiple languages including Hindi, Tamil, Thai, and Arabic.
Tera FM works directly in your browser — no app download required. It works on desktop, mobile, and tablet. Just visit tera.fm and press play.
